Print Rikin 2 is a very bold, normal width, low cont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

A heavy, forward-leaning handwritten print with rounded terminals and a brush-like stroke that stays largely monoline. Letterforms are compact and slightly bouncy, with softened corners and subtle, natural irregularities that keep the texture lively without becoming messy. Counters are generally open and generous for the weight, and the overall rhythm shows gentle variation in character widths and interior shapes, reinforcing an informal, drawn feel.
Best suited for short-to-medium display settings where a friendly, attention-grabbing script-like print is needed—such as posters, packaging callouts, café or menu headings, stickers, and social media graphics. It can also work for branding accents and punchy subheads when set with comfortable spacing to preserve clarity at smaller sizes.
The font projects a warm, upbeat personality with a sporty, approachable tone. Its bold, slanted silhouettes and soft curves create an energetic, conversational voice that feels more fun than formal.
The design appears intended to mimic quick brush lettering in a bold, legible print style—capturing the spontaneity of hand-drawn marks while maintaining consistent shapes for repeatable, display-focused typography.
Capitals read as simple, sturdy shapes with softened shoulders, while lowercase forms lean into a more handwritten cadence with occasional looped joins and brushy taper hints. Numerals match the same chunky, rounded construction, keeping a consistent color across mixed text.
